Method
- Preheat the oven to 375°F.
- Lightly coat a 9x13-inch baking dish with nonstick cooking spray.
- In a large mixing bowl, combine the softened cream cheese, crab meat, green onions, garlic powder, soy sauce, and Worcestershire sauce.
- Stir thoroughly until the mixture becomes smooth and evenly combined.
- Arrange half of the wonton wrappers across the bottom of the baking dish.
- Spread half of the crab mixture evenly over the wonton wrappers.
- Add another layer of wonton wrappers over the filling.
- Spread the remaining crab mixture evenly over the second wonton layer.
- Sprinkle the mozzarella cheese evenly across the top.
- Bake uncovered for 25 to 30 minutes until the cheese melts, the edges become golden brown, and the filling bubbles around the sides.
- Allow the casserole to rest for 10 minutes before serving.

Notes
Use softened cream cheese for the smoothest filling. Fresh crab and imitation crab both work well. Avoid overbaking because the filling can dry out and the wonton layers may become too crisp. Allow the casserole to rest before serving so the layers set properly. For extra crunch, lightly spray the top layer with cooking spray before baking.
